DSX earnings/chart
Reports Q2 (Jun) earnings of $0.21 per share, $0.02 better than the Capital IQ Consensus Estimate of $0.19; revenues fell 10.3% year/year to $58.2 mln vs the $55.44 mln consensus. Time charter revenues were $57.6 million for Q2 of 2012, compared to $64.6 million for the same period of 2011, mainly due to reduced time charter rates. Separately, the Co also announced that it has entered into time charter contracts with Ultrabulk A/S, Copenhagen, Denmark, through separate wholly-owned subsidiaries, for two of its Panamax dry bulk carriers, the m/v "Naias" and the m/v "Oceanis". The gross charter rate for each vessel is US$9,250/day, minus a 5% commission paid to third parties, for a period of minimum seventeen months to maximum twenty-three months.
